If you are thinking of a HTC desire (I have one) I would say that the internal storage is rubbish, however the good news is that rooting and installing cyanogen mod 7 is really easy and with e2sd you can move your dalvik cache (android Java bit cache) to an ext partition and that frees up a huge amount of space. I wrote a blog post on how to do it http://www.strangeparty.com/2011/06/23/cyanogenmod-on-htc/
I do reccomend rooting (it is even easier before you have data to back up) it as you really run out of space quickly otherwise.
